The beauty of this recipe lies in its simplicity. There's no complicated chopping or sautéing involved; simply combine the rice and water, pop it in the oven, and let it bake. The result is perfectly cooked rice, fluffy and tender, every single time. I’ve experimented with both long-grain white and brown rice, and both produce excellent results. For brown rice, I just add a few extra minutes to the baking time, ensuring it's cooked through.
